Sashimi Ingredients

Method

Preparation Instructions

1

Slice the Hamachi

Using a sharp knife, slice the yellowtail hamachi into thin, even slices, about 1/4 inch thick. Arrange the slices on a chilled plate.

2

Prepare the Jalapeno

Remove the seeds from the jalapeno and slice it into thin rings. You can adjust the quantity of jalapeno based on your heat preference.

3

Drizzle and Season

Drizzle the ponzu sauce over the sliced hamachi. Sprinkle black lava salt over the top to enhance the flavor.

4

Garnish

Place the jalapeno rings on top of the sashimi for a spicy kick and visual appeal.
